Abstract

Youth dropping out of school in Mesjid Peunteut Village, Blang Mangat District, Lhokseumawe City as a partner village were still less productive and have an impact on low income levels. In fact, they have never received training from any party for entrepreneurial activities and have the expertise to create certain products, especially in the field of civil engineering. This training aimed to provide knowledge and skills to out-of-school youth in order to provide them with the expertise to make seamless texture paving block products that are easy to market so as to generate a steady income. The number of participants involved in the activity were 20 people, consisted of 8 women and 12 men with an age range of 20 - 25 years. Partners acquired theoretical knowledge, technical skills in making paving block texture seamless manual products, production management and product marketing. The offline method was used for theoretical debriefing activities combined with presentation techniques in class and hands-on practice in civil engineering workshops. The results of the training obtained an average value of theoretical understanding of 88.1 and technical understanding of 95. This showed partners have acquired theoretical and technical knowledge to plan mix compositions, manufacture products manually, arrange production and marketing costs. Thus, it becomes a job field for youth who drop out of school to get a steady income.

Abstract

Environmentally conscious development is essentially a sustainable development process. Rapid urban activity has a positive impact on economic development. One negative impact caused by rapid urban activity is flooding. The high activity of urban communities due to population growth has resulted in a lack of green land and rainwater absorption areas used to provide urban infrastructure and facilities, including water drainage. This also occurs in Bireuen Regency, a Regency in Aceh dominated by office, trade, housing, and residential activities. Kota Juang District is the center of government in Bireuen Regency, which is dominated by residential areas. Based on the results of initial observations conducted in Kota Juang District, many land cover areas cannot absorb water during high rainfall intensity, resulting in waterlogging at road intersections and in office areas and densely populated residential areas. The average water level during high rainfall intensity is in the range of 60-30 cm, causing local flooding. The writing of this article is based on a literature review where the main source of data used is Google Scholar. A qualitative descriptive data analysis method was applied in this study to describe the phenomenon. So, there is an appropriate problem solving regarding retention ponds in residential areas.
